Application May Not Open Handle to Plug and Play Device Connected to a USB Hub (259711)

This article was previously published under Q259711 SYMPTOMS
When you remove a Plug and Play Universal Serial Bus (USB) hub (a surprise removal) and an application does not close the handle to a device connected to the hub, the application may not open the handle to the device when you plug in the USB hub again.
CAUSE
This behavior occurs because the USB driver does not correctly handle the surprise removal of Plug and Play USB devices.

WORKAROUND
To work around this issue, close the device handle when the application receives a "Device Removal" notification message.
STATUSMicrosoft has confirmed that this is a problem in Microsoft Windows 2000.
This problem was first corrected in Windows 2000 Service Pack 1.
